Improved Visual Design and Readability
A significant part of our effort concentrated on visual clarity https://luckyhillss.com/. This benefits all players, notably those with low vision, color blindness, or anyone who desires to reduce eye fatigue. We implemented a enhanced color contrast system for all text and buttons, ensuring information pops clearly from the background. Font sizes now scale more reliably, so you can use your browser’s zoom without the page layout breaking. We also revamped many icons and graphics to be more clear, so they don’t depend solely on color to communicate their purpose. Players can also use a new visual settings panel to switch on a high-contrast mode or change text spacing. These adjustments add up to a more readable and pleasant interface, whether you’re playing for five minutes or five hours.
Improved Keyboard Navigation and Motor Control
Many players can’t use a mouse, or merely prefer not to. That’s why we guaranteed you can operate every part of LuckyHills Casino with just a keyboard. You can now navigate to any interactive feature, from selecting a slot game to changing your profile, using the tab, arrow, and enter keys. We added clear visual focus indicators so you always know which button or link is active, which helps avoid confusion. For players who have trouble with precise movements, we enlarged the size and spacing of clickable areas like buttons and form fields. This minimizes the risk of clicking the wrong thing. The aim is to give you several equally effective ways to interact with our site, so you can select the method that fits your physical needs without hindering you.
Complete Screen Reader Accessibility
Ensuring the platform completely workable with screen readers was a key priority. We meticulously added descriptive alt text to each important image, button, and graphic, so the technology can convey what’s on screen. We also reworked the website’s underlying code to use a clear heading structure and added appropriate ARIA (Accessible Rich Internet Applications) labels in key spots. This offers players who use assistive tech a straightforward way to move through our menus, game listings, and promo pages. Each piece of content we deliver should be reachable through more than one sense. This upgrade transforms that principle a truth for blind and visually impaired players.
More organized Content Structure and Predictable Layouts
Cognitive accessibility is about keeping information easy to understand and interfaces easy to navigate. To aid with this, we streamlined our language where we could, eliminating casino jargon and giving plain explanations for bonus terms or game rules. We harmonized our page designs and navigation menus. Once you learn how to use one part of the site, you can use that knowledge everywhere else. Important messages and warnings now are the same and show up in consistent spots. By reducing the mental effort needed and establishing predictable patterns, we support players with dyslexia, attention disorders, or other cognitive differences zero in on playing the games, not on struggling with the website.
